Cod Satrusayang - Wednesday’s sentence against former prime minister Yingluck Shinawatra is the latest blow against the influence of her family and its political machine, both of which still wield considerable power in Thailand. ugg boots sale uk Analysts argue that the military’s main goal in taking power in a May 2014 coup was to curtail both Yingluck and her brother Thaksin’s stranglehold on Thai politics which the army views as a threat to the established order. In addition to the conviction against Yingluck for criminal negligence, the judicial system under the junta has convicted several senior members of the Shinawatra-led Pheu Thai party to lengthy jail terms. air jordan 11 soldes Former commerce minister Boonsong Teriyapirom was sentenced to 42 years in August for corruption related to the rice subsidy scheme. womens air jordan However, politicians cast doubt whether Wednesday’s verdict would really derail Thaksin’s influence on the political scene. “The verdict is merely about Yingluck. cheap uggs If she doesn’t want to go to jail, she can spend the rest of her life on the run,” said Paiboon Nititawan, a member of the junta’s National Reform Council and a former senator. “As for Thaksin, I don’t think this deters him from continuing to lead the Pheu Thai party from abroad,” he said. new balance 990 Thaksin is unlikely to back down despite the guilty verdict agains this sister, observers said. cheap ugg boots uk Although many Thais accepted the 2014 military coup due to political fatigue after a decade of instability and street protests, continued military rule could be met with resistance. Air Jordan XX9 “The military will be in power for over four years by the time elections are held late next year,” said a former Pheu Thai lawmaker who asked to not be named. asics soldes “Thaksin and Yingluck are still extremely popular among the base, the people will not accept more delays and more attempts to bully our party.” The military has tried to cement its future position however. A constitution drafted by the army to guide the country after elections also allows the military to appoint the upper house of parliament and contains clauses for an unelected prime minister. According to Kan, continuing conflict between political factions could lead to mass protests down the line. “The junta’s stability will severely deteriorate... and at a certain point it might spark huge protests if no one will give in and back down,” he said.
